punch and judy -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 :

  Punch \Punch\, n. [Abbrev, fr. punchinello.]
     The buffoon or harlequin of a puppet show.
     [1913 Webster]
  
     Punch and Judy, a puppet show in which a comical little
        hunchbacked Punch, with a large nose, engages in
        altercation with his wife Judy.
